This book describes quercetin, a naturally occurring plant flavonoid, discussing its occurrence, impact on the body's defenses, and potential applications. Chapters address such topics as quercetin’s role in metabolism, mechanism of action, potential use as a supplement in different forms, and its antiviral, antibacterial, anti-inflammatory, antioxidant, and anticancer qualities.
